Why Oman Needs Advanced Energy Storage Systems

As Oman accelerates its renewable energy adoption under Vision 2040, the demand for reliable energy storage power solutions has skyrocketed. Did you know the Sultanate plans to generate 30% of its electricity from renewables by 2030? That's where specialized manufacturers step in - bridging the gap between solar/wind power generation and stable grid supply.

FAQs: Oman Energy Storage Solutions

What's the typical lifespan of industrial storage systems?

Modern lithium systems last 15-20 years with proper maintenance, compared to 8-10 years for traditional lead-acid solutions.

How does Oman's climate affect storage performance?

High-quality systems maintain 95%+ efficiency up to 50°C through advanced liquid cooling - crucial for Omani installations.
